King of Cups & Five of Swords
Combined Meaning
When the King of Cups and the Five of Swords appear together, their combined message revolves around managing conflict with emotional intelligence and grace. This pairing encourages a balanced approach to disputes, blending compassion with strategic thinking.
Together, these cards highlight the challenge of maintaining emotional maturity amid tension and competition. The King of Cups offers a steady, empathetic presence that can defuse hostility, while the Five of Swords reveals the potential pitfalls of conflict, urging mindfulness about the cost of winning. This combination suggests that true victory is achieved not through dominance, but by navigating disagreements with integrity, understanding, and emotional resilience.

Advice from the Cards
General Advice
Approach conflicts with a calm and compassionate heart. Use emotional intelligence to guide you through disputes, striving for solutions that respect all parties. Avoid winning at the expense of integrity.
Love Advice
In relationships, this pair advises handling disagreements with empathy and kindness. Focus on understanding your partner’s feelings and seek peaceful resolutions rather than ‘winning’ arguments.
Career Advice
At work, maintain professionalism and emotional control during conflicts. Strategic thinking combined with compassion can help you resolve tensions and emerge respected rather than resented.
Health Advice
Manage stress from conflicts by cultivating emotional balance. Practices like meditation or counseling can support your mental well-being and help prevent the negative effects of tension.
